South Africa's $5.8-billion green hydrogen-ammonia project is 'going really well'

The $5.8-billion green hydrogen-ammonia project in South Africa's Nelson Mandela Bay has been a hard slog but there is light at the end of the tunnel.
Mining Weekly can report the venture, for which a green hydrogen generating electrolyser and ammonia loop solution has already been selected, is "going really well" and developer Hive Hydrogen is expected to make "some very big announcements" at next month's Africa Green Hydrogen Summit in Cape Town.
The Eastern Cape's special economic zone at the Coega port is the site of the project, where construction could potentially begin early next year and commissioning in December 2029.
Hive Hydrogen South Africa chairperson is former Eskom CEO Thulani Gcabashe, whose Built Africa focuses on developing renewable-energy projects in South Africa under the Renewable Energy Independent Power Producer Procurement Programme.
Backed by Hive Energy and Built Africa, Hive Hydrogen South Africa has since September 2019 been working on establishing a renewable energy-powered green hydrogen-derived ammonia plant capable of producing a million tonnes of product a year.
The conclusion of environmental impact assessment work on Hive Hydrogen's 3 300 MW of renewable energy assets gave rise to environmental authorisation of the 1 000 MW Carissa wind energy facility, near Beaufort West.
Carissa's permitting is the work of a partnership made up of Hive Hydrogen, project developer AMDA Developments, and Blue Crane Environmental, the independent environmental assessment practitioner responsible for leading the environmental impact assessment process.
Coega is one of Hive's three green hydrogen schemes, the other two being Albamed in Spain and Gente Grande in Chile.
Blended finance private equity fund SA-H2, which focuses on the green hydrogen value chain and the Southern African energy transition, has signed a development funding agreement with Hive.
SA-H2, which combines public and private capital, has secured commitments from the European Commission under the Global Gateway, Invest International, South Africa's Public Investment Corporation, on behalf of the Government Employees Pension Fund, Sanlam Life, and the Industrial Development Corporation. The fund is also being supported by the Development Bank of Southern Africa.
SASOL HYDROGEN SYSTEM COMMISSIONED
Also in South Africa, chemicals and synthetic fuels producer Sasol has commissioned a platinum-based proton exchange membrane (PEM) hydrogen electrolyser system at its research and technology campus, in Sasolburg, in the Free State. In addition to Sasol's contribution, the electrolyser was developed with contributions from the Department of Science, Technology and Innovation's Hydrogen South Africa programme in partnership with the South African National Energy Development Institute and North-West University.
Central to the deployment of the 2 kW PEM electrolyser system is the beneficiation of South Africa's platinum group metals, which were described by Science, Technology and Innovation Minister Professor Blade Nzimande as being key to fuelling industries of the future. The Minister added that the project would generate the knowledge required to support the commercialisation and wider deployment of green hydrogen technologies.
China's green technology company Envision Energy is partnering Sasol around the study of a potential green hydrogen system also at Sasolburg. Ammonia Energy Association reports that China is continuing to lead the way in building early green hydrogen supply chains.
